Want to travel to Copenhagen but on a tight budget?

📍 Itinerary Overview 🚩 Sightseeing Route 🏖️ Must-Visit Attractions 1. Green Kayak App (location: Kayak Republic) We booked in advanced a date for a FREE kayaking experience — you just have to pick trash up you see in the waters! (Equipment provided) Wear clothes you’re prepared to get wet in, there’s a toilet at the bar that is managing the kayaks. Bring a lock if you want to keep things in their lockers if not you can rent it from them. Avoid the big boats around If not, this spot also rents out kayaks - prices are on the picture! 2. Christiana Town (FREE to explore) This used to be a place where you can’t take any pictures. But now it has transformed into a chill place with lots of food and handmade items for sale! 3. Trinitatis Kirke Beautiful church to enter for FREE - right next to the round tower 🚇 Transportation We walked everywhere! 📷 Photo Spots 🍜 Local Cuisine - I downloaded an app called Early Bird where you can book spots in restaurants at different times for a discount! We had food at Fromberg (fusion food) Ferment (cocktails) Bought rye bread and sourdough bread as a souvenir - if traveling from other European countries! Bought it at Emmerys (on the way to Christiana) 🏠 Accommodation 1.City Hotel Nebo - Not really recommended for long stays but it was enough for a night for three of us - shared bathroom but private room - located right at central station which was convenient 💡 Tips Want to travel to Copenhagen but on a tight budget? Plan for these earlier and also be flexible according to the weather ☀️

Just got back from Copenhagen and honestly… what a vibe. It’s one of those cities that feels super chill but still packed with personality. The whole place is unbelievably clean, everyone’s on bikes, and there’s this low-key cozy energy that just kind of seeps into your bones. Nyhavn is picture-perfect (yes, it’s touristy, but it’s cute so who cares?), and I might’ve eaten my weight in cinnamon buns and smørrebrød. Found this quirky little food market at Reffen that was giving warehouse-meets-street-food-heaven. Also tried to blend in with the locals by sipping coffee in like 4 different minimalist cafés. It felt… aspirational. What surprised me most was how easy the city is to get around. Metro shows up like magic, and people are actually nice when you ask for directions. Christiania was wild in its own way—definitely a side of the city I wasn’t expecting, but glad I saw it. Copenhagen isn’t cheap (like, your wallet will notice), but it’s got that clean, organized, eco-friendly thing going that kind of makes up for it. You just feel healthier being there. Would go back in a heartbeat, maybe with a bit more budgeting next time 😅 #CopenhagenDiaries #ScandiStyle #copenhagen
